Buying Guide for the Best Rugged Barcode Scanners

When choosing a rugged barcode scanner, it's important to consider the environment in which it will be used and the specific needs of your business. Rugged barcode scanners are designed to withstand harsh conditions, making them ideal for industries like warehousing, manufacturing, and field services. To ensure you select the best fit for your needs, you should evaluate several key specifications that determine the scanner's performance, durability, and usability.
DurabilityDurability refers to the scanner's ability to withstand drops, dust, water, and extreme temperatures. This is crucial for environments where the scanner might be exposed to rough handling or harsh conditions. Durability is often measured by the Ingress Protection (IP) rating and drop test ratings. An IP rating of IP65 or higher indicates strong resistance to dust and water. Drop test ratings, such as surviving multiple drops from 6 feet onto concrete, indicate robustness. Choose a scanner with high durability if it will be used in tough environments.
Scanning TechnologyScanning technology determines how the scanner reads barcodes. There are two main types: laser and imager (camera-based). Laser scanners are good for reading 1D barcodes from a distance, while imagers can read both 1D and 2D barcodes and are better for damaged or poorly printed codes. If you need to scan a variety of barcode types or expect to encounter damaged barcodes, an imager might be the better choice. For long-range scanning, a laser scanner could be more suitable.
ConnectivityConnectivity options include wired (USB, RS232) and wireless (Bluetooth, Wi-Fi) connections. Wired scanners are reliable and don't require battery management, making them ideal for stationary use. Wireless scanners offer more flexibility and mobility, which is beneficial in large warehouses or retail environments. Consider how the scanner will be used and choose the connectivity option that best fits your workflow.
Battery LifeBattery life is important for wireless barcode scanners, as it determines how long the scanner can operate before needing a recharge. Longer battery life means less downtime and increased productivity. Battery life can range from a few hours to a full workday or more. If the scanner will be used continuously throughout the day, look for models with extended battery life or quick charging capabilities.
ErgonomicsErgonomics refers to the design of the scanner and how comfortable it is to use over extended periods. A well-designed scanner should be easy to hold, lightweight, and have intuitive button placement. This is especially important if the scanner will be used frequently or for long shifts. Consider the size and weight of the scanner and choose one that feels comfortable and reduces user fatigue.
Scanning Speed and AccuracyScanning speed and accuracy determine how quickly and reliably the scanner can read barcodes. High-speed scanners can process multiple barcodes rapidly, which is essential in fast-paced environments. Accuracy ensures that even damaged or poorly printed barcodes are read correctly. Look for scanners with high scanning speeds and advanced decoding capabilities if efficiency and reliability are critical for your operations.
User Interface and Software CompatibilityThe user interface and software compatibility affect how easily the scanner integrates with your existing systems. Some scanners come with customizable interfaces and are compatible with various operating systems and software applications. Ensure that the scanner you choose can seamlessly connect with your inventory management, point-of-sale, or other relevant systems. This will streamline operations and reduce the need for additional software or hardware adjustments.
